NSWPFA Powerchair Reserve Grade

The NSWPFA Powerchair Reserve Grade competition features up and coming footballers, still working on skill development but now also having a tactical focus. Our Reserve Grade athletes receive dedicated coaching as a group during our open training sessions, highlighting the more technical elements of powerchair football.

With our four Reserve Grade teams now operating as part of a club, growing athletes can now receive mentorship from more senior Premier League athletes and coaches, fast tracking their development and providing a taste of what the top grade is like.
